Non-Attached in the Brandenburger Landtag: "We Are Happy if Bsw Members Join Us

Summary by Der Tagesspiegel
In the Potsdamer Landtag the former BSW deputy Andre von Ossowski is now sitting at a single table. As it goes on for the party and factionless now and what he plans to do.
